Fosroc Lokfix E77

(supersedes Lokfix E75) constructive solutions

High performance pure epoxy 3:1 resin cartridge system,


for anchoring reinforcement and fixings into a variety of
substrates.
Description
Lokfix E77 is a two-component Epoxy anchoring material,
supplied in 3:1 ratio side-by-side cartridges with a static mixer
nozzle. When applied it sets and cures to firmly secure a variety
of steel fixings into concrete and solid masonry substrates.
Other grades of Lokfix are also available

Lokfix E35 Rapid curing resin anchor cartridge system based on


styrene free polyester for lightweight anchoring.

Lokfix E55/E45 Rapid curing resin anchor cartridge system


based on styrene free vinyl-ester for heavy /medium duty
anchoring.
Uses
For concrete (solid, porous and light) and solid masonry.

Chemical resistance
Lokfix E77 has resistance to a wide variety of chemicals.
Consult Fosroc technical department for specific data.

Table 2 - Lokfix E77 Gel & Dry Curing Times with EN1992-4 (2018).

Substrate Gel Time **Dry Curing


All values in mm unless otherwise stated.
Temp. (mins) Time (hrs)
0ºC 90 144 ▪ Data provided does not form part of the EAD

+10 ºC 60 28 For all other conditions including 100-year design life,


+20 ºC 30 12 increased concrete strength, fixings into solid masonry types,

+30 ºC 12 9 fixings into cracked concrete, fixings subject to seismic

+40ºC 8 4 conditions and post installation of reinforcement refer to the


relevant method statement, EAD document or use the design
For optimal use the cartridge temperature should be between software www.lokfix.com, also available through your local
+5ºC to +40ºC. Note general storage conditions. technical office.

**The stated curing time is for dry conditions. In wet/damp


conditions, the curing time will double.

Be aware that the substrate temperature can vary significantly


from the ambient temperature.

Table 3 - Rebar Anchoring Setting Parameters
– details below

Rebar Anchor Size Ø8 Ø10 Ø12 Ø14 Ø16 Ø20 Ø24 Ø25 Ø28 Ø32 Ø36 «
Ø40 «

Min. Edge Distance Cmin 35 40 45 50 50 60 70 70 75 85 180 200


Min. Spacing Smin 40 50 60 70 75 90 120 120 130 150 180 200
Max. Embedment Depth hef,, max 160 200 240 280 320 400 480 500 560 640 720 800
Min. Embedment Depth hef,, min 60 60 70 75 80 90 96 100 112 128 144 240
hef +30mm
Min. Part Thickness hmin ≥100mm
hef +2d0

Min. Drill Diameter D0, min 10 12 14 18 20 25 30 30 35 40 45 50


Max. Drill Diameter D0, max 12 14 16 18 20 25 32 32 35 40 45 50

Table 4 - Threaded Rod Anchoring Setting Parameters


– details below

Anchor Size M8 M10 M12 M16 M20 M24 M27 M30 M33  M36  M39  M42  M48 

Min. Edge Distance Cmin 35 40 45 50 60 65 75 80 165 180 195 210 240


Min. Spacing Smin 40 50 60 75 95 115 125 140 165 180 195 210 240

Max. Embedment Depth hef,max 160 200 240 320 400 480 540 600 660 720 780 840 960
Min. Embedment Depth hef,min 60 60 70 80 90 96 108 120 132 144 156 168 192
Min Part Thickness hmin hef +30mm ≥100mm hef +2d0
Drill Diameter d0 10 12 14 18 22 28 30 35 38 42 45 52 60
Max. Installation Torque
Tinst. 10 20 40 60 100 170 250 300 330 360 390 460 550
(Nm)

Table 5 - Example Fixing loads

Fixing diameter 8 10 12 14 16 20 24 25 27 28

Embedment depth hef, 80 90 110 115 125 170 210 210 250 250
Edge distance C 120 135 165 173 188 255 315 315 375 375
Spacing S 240 270 330 345 375 510 630 630 750 750
Tension load for Threaded rod (kN) 13.8 20.0 27.0 - 32.7 51.9 71.3 - 92.6 -
Tension load for rebar (kN) 14.3 20.0 27.0 28.9 32.7 51.9 68.8 71.3 - 92.6

Fixing diameter 30 32 33  36  39  40  42  48 

Embedment depth hef, 270 270 320 350 380 380 420 480
Edge distance C 405 405 480 525 570 570 630 720
Spacing S 810 810 960 1050 1140 1140 1260 1440
Tension load for Threaded rod (kN) 103.9 - 111.7 127.8 144.6 - 168.0 205.3
Tension load for rebar (kN) - 103.9 - 127.8 - 144.6 - -

Note : Greater/lesser loads per fixing are possible depending


on embedment depth and other factors. Consult Fosroc
technical for advice.
